KnoCommerce and Delighted are customer feedback platforms tailored for ecommerce businesses, each offering distinct features and functionalities. KnoCommerce specializes in post-purchase attribution surveys with multi-question flows and zero-party data collection, primarily integrating with Shopify. Delighted provides simple NPS, CSAT, and CES surveys via email and SMS, supporting various ecommerce platforms.
Core Features and Functionality
KnoCommerce focuses on capturing detailed customer insights through multi-question surveys embedded in the Shopify post-purchase experience. It offers advanced question types, personalized survey logic, and robust attribution reporting, enabling businesses to link feedback directly to purchase behavior. However, its functionality is primarily centered around post-purchase interactions within the Shopify ecosystem.
Delighted delivers straightforward NPS, CSAT, and CES surveys through email and SMS, facilitating quick customer satisfaction assessments. Its simplicity allows for rapid deployment and broad reach across various customer touchpoints. The tool is designed for ease of use, making it accessible for businesses seeking efficient feedback collection without complex setup. Nonetheless, it lacks the depth of customization and attribution capabilities found in KnoCommerce.
Pricing and Value
KnoCommerce offers tiered pricing:
- Starter: $19/month
- Analyst: $119/month
- Pro: $299/month
Each plan provides varying levels of survey capacity, question types, and integrations, with higher tiers offering more advanced features. (knocommerce.com)
Delighted's pricing is structured as follows:
- Free: Up to 25 responses/month
- Starter: $19/month
- Growth: $39/month
- Advanced: $149/month
- Premium: $249/month
These plans scale with response volume and feature access, catering to businesses of different sizes and needs. (knocommerce.com)
Ease of Setup and Use
KnoCommerce requires integration with Shopify and setup of multi-question survey flows, which may involve a learning curve for users unfamiliar with survey design or Shopify Liquid customizations. The platform is best suited for businesses with dedicated resources for survey management and analysis.
Delighted is praised for its minimal setup time and intuitive interface, allowing users to launch surveys quickly with pre-built templates. Its straightforward approach is ideal for businesses seeking fast feedback loops without dedicated resources for survey management.
Integrations
KnoCommerce integrates deeply with Shopify, embedding surveys directly into the post-purchase experience. It also supports Zapier for extended integrations with other platforms, though native integrations outside Shopify are limited.
Delighted offers a broader range of integrations, including Shopify, Zendesk, HubSpot, Salesforce, and Slack, making it adaptable for businesses relying on multiple platforms for customer communication and support.
Customer Support and Documentation
KnoCommerce provides email and chat support with a knowledge base to assist customers. Users have reported responsive support, though it may be slower compared to larger SaaS vendors.
Delighted offers email, live chat, and phone support, along with extensive documentation and user forums. This comprehensive support ecosystem benefits businesses that value quick resolutions and onboarding help.
Best-Fit Customer Profile
KnoCommerce is ideal for ecommerce brands using Shopify that require detailed post-purchase attribution insights through multi-question surveys. It suits businesses needing segmentation and attribution for marketing optimization.
Delighted is better suited for companies seeking quick, scalable customer satisfaction measurement using established frameworks like NPS or CSAT, with easy deployment via email and SMS. It fits businesses that prioritize volume and ease of use over survey complexity.
